What does a frontend software engineer intern do?

A Frontend Software Engineer Intern assists in designing and developing the user-facing parts of websites or web applications. They typically work with techn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, and may use frameworks such as React, Angular, or Vue.js. Their responsibilities often include implementing visual elements, ensuring responsive design, fixing bugs, and collaborating with designers and backend developers. This role provides hands-on experience in creating interactive and accessible user interfaces, while learning best practices in coding and teamwork.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a frontend software engineer intern?

To thrive as a Frontend Software Engineer Intern, you need a solid understanding of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and basic programming principles, often supported by coursework or personal projects. Familiarity with frameworks like React or Angular, version control systems such as Git, and tools like npm or webpack is typically expected.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ate and collaborate within a team are standout soft skills for this role. These skills ensure you can effectively contribute to building user-friendly, efficient web interfaces while learning and adapting in a dynamic tech environment.

What are some common challenges faced by frontend software engineer interns during their internship?

Frontend Software Engineer Interns often face challenges such as adapting to new frameworks and development tools, understanding and following established codebases, and balancing the need for clean, maintainable code with tight project deadlines. Interns may also find it challenging to communicate effectively with designers and backend engineers to ensure seamless integration of UI and functionality. However, these challenges offer valuable learning opportunities and help interns quickly develop technical and collaborative skills in a real-world setting.
